Leapmotor is preparing to introduce its new compact electric hatchback, the Leapmotor A05, with a market debut expected in May followed by an official launch in June. The model represents a critical addition to the company’s expanding electric portfolio and is positioned to strengthen its presence in the budget EV segment. The A05 follows the earlier A10 in the A-series lineup and has already completed regulatory filings, indicating readiness for commercialization. With this launch, the company aims to enhance its competitiveness in the fast-growing electric vehicle market.

Product Positioning and Market Competition

The Leapmotor A05 is designed to compete directly with established compact electric vehicles in the market. Measuring 4,200 mm in length with a wheelbase of 2,605 mm, the vehicle fits squarely within the urban EV category. Its size and specifications position it against rivals such as the BYD Dolphin and Geely Xingyuan. By targeting the budget-conscious segment, Leapmotor aims to capture a broader customer base while maintaining strong value propositions in terms of performance and technology.

Powertrain and Battery Options

The A05 offers flexibility with two motor configurations, delivering 70 kW and 90 kW of power respectively. These options allow customers to choose based on performance requirements and cost considerations. The vehicle is equipped with battery packs sourced from multiple suppliers, including Gotion High-tech, ensuring supply chain diversification and scalability. This approach supports production consistency while enabling competitive pricing in a segment where affordability plays a crucial role in purchase decisions.

Driving Range and Advanced Features

The compact electric hatchback provides two range options, offering 405 kilometers and 510 kilometers depending on the configuration. These range figures make the A05 suitable for both daily urban commuting and extended travel needs. A notable feature is the optional roof-mounted LiDAR system, which introduces advanced sensing capability into a budget vehicle segment. This technology, once limited to premium vehicles, reflects the industry trend of democratizing advanced driver-assistance hardware across lower price categories.

Strategic Role in Sales Growth Targets

The launch of the A05 aligns with Leapmotor’s aggressive expansion strategy, which targets annual deliveries of one million vehicles by 2026. The company reported nearly 600,000 vehicle deliveries in 2025, marking a significant milestone among emerging EV manufacturers. Management has indicated that approximately 600,000 units of the 2026 target will come from newly introduced models, including the A05, while existing models are expected to contribute around 400,000 units. This highlights the importance of new product introductions in driving future growth.

Upcoming Product Pipeline Expansion

In addition to the A05, Leapmotor is preparing to introduce another electric vehicle, the D99 MPV, during the summer period. This expansion into multiple vehicle segments demonstrates the company’s intent to diversify its portfolio and address varying consumer needs. By strengthening its presence across hatchbacks and multi-purpose vehicles, Leapmotor aims to enhance market coverage and improve its competitive positioning in the rapidly evolving electric mobility landscape.
